THE PEOPLE SPEAK – Voters have choice of two Romneys

— Some of my friends are not fans of Obama and say rude things about him. I assume they will vote for Mitt Romney. But which Romney?

The old one who said in 2002, “I will preserve and protect a woman’s right to choose”, or the current Romney who opposes abortion except “in case of rape, incest or life endangerment of the mother” The Romney who voted for the Brady Act to restrict some gun sales or the current Romney who touts the NRA position.

The old Romney who said “The Democratic stimulus will accelerate the timing of the start of the recovery” or the current Romney who said “The stimulus package is a failure.” The auto bailout, when Romney first said “Let Detroit go bankrupt” to the current Romney “The bailout, It was my idea.”

On health care reform, in 2007 Romney said “The Massachusetts plan will be a model for the nation” to currently saying “Such plans should be left to the states.”

Maybe he feels he should say whatever he needs to say to get elected, but with mind changes like the above who knows what he really would try to do if elected.

ROBERT A. WEAVER

Muskogee
